Hidden pictures:
Go to where Zelda is met for the first time. Look into the window on her left, as you enter. Pictures of Yoshi, Princess Toadstool, Mario, Bowser and Luigi can be seen. Look from different angles to see them all. Throw something into the window with Mario to receive 20 rupees. Throwing something into the other window will result in a lit bomb being thrown back at Link.

When you talk to Princess Zelda, after you have collected the Forest Stone from the Deku Tree, both sides of the courtyard have windows. On one side are three to four pictures of other Nintendo characters. The other side appears to be empty. However, if you shoot a Deku Seed with the Fairy Sling Shot at the empty window, you will see a little "Easter egg" from the programmers.

Hint: R2D2 appearance:
Go into the Bombchu Bowling Alley in the market as child Link. Press C-Up to switch to the first-person look-around view. Look at the music machine of the bowling alley to see that R2D2 has found an interesting job.

Hint: Breaking open boxes:
To break open a regular brown wooden box, just run at it and press A. Link will roll and smash open the box. This is useful when finding all the chickens and to get a Skulltula in the Marketplace room with the pots.

Hint: Z-target anything:
The following trick allows you to Z-target objects that cannot normally be Z-targeted. Press A to check an object, and hold Z while you read the description. Keep holding Z after the text disappears, and you will be targeting it. Try this on the mat in front of Darunia's room, the grave in the front of the graveyard, or the Triforce symbols in the Great Fairies' homes.

Hint: Items from trees:
Roll into a tree in Hyrule field or in a town. The tree will randomly give Rupees, Hearts, Deku Nuts or other items, but at times will not give anything. Note: If you roll into the tree near a bunch of stones in a circle at Hyrule Castle, a golden Skulltula will appear. This trick also works at the tree closest to the entrance at Kakario village and Zora's river.

Hint: The chicken game:
When at Lon Lon Ranch, go visit Talon, the character you woke up before at Hyrule Castle. Accept his offer when he asks if you want to play a chicken game. To catch the three chickens, move to the corners of the room and just start grabbing all the chickens. It helps if you watch where at least one of them lands, to capture one quickly. As a reward for completing the game, Link will receive a bottle of milk which restores five hearts to his health.
To capture the chickens easily, pick up all the chickens before talking to Talon. Place the chickens in the corner between the table, the stairs, and Talon. They will stay there and allow Link to find the super chickens without the other chickens wandering around.

Hint: Target Cucco:
Enter Lon-Lon ranch, as an adult. Go to the former Super Cucco room when it is empty of everything but chickens. Pick up a Cucco and equip the Hover-Boots. Climb the stairs and jump towards the shelf opposite with a crate and bucket on it. You will land underneath and see a shadow on the shelf, where the crate should be but nothing above it. You will also see just the front side of the bucket and crate. Throw the Cucco and it will fly through the shelf, landing on top. After a while it will fall off the shelf. You will now be able to Z-target this Cucco, but no others.
Hint: Chicken attack:
Repeatedly assault a Cucco (chicken) with any weapon or run over it with Epona. This will result in hundreds of chickens causing you lose life when they attack. They cannot harm you if you are on Epona.

Hint: Free key in the Gerudo Training Grounds:
Go into the lava room in which you must collect silver rupees in the Gerudo Training Grounds. Stand on the first platform and use the Song Of Time. You can jump to the two time blocks and grab the key above. If you keep going ahead, you will find the key room where you open the locked doors. You will find three treasure chests there. Do not open the door to the left. Only go to the right when you enter the key room in the entrance of the training ground. Note: Once you go back into the lava room, you will have to retrieve all the rupees you collected earlier. This is also another way to go through the room with only a hookshot.

Hint: Change Gerudo Guards color:
After rescuing the last man in the Gerudo's Fortress, a woman will appear and say that you are free to enter the fortress at any time. When she finishes, change your clothes (green, red or blue). The Gerudo will change the color of her lipstick, clothes and shoes. Note: This only works once. When you return later or save the game, she will be gone for the rest of the game.

Hint: Great fairy locations:
Great fairy of power:
This Great fairy gives Link the "spin slash" attack. She is located at Death Mountain, outside the crater to the left of the entrance, behind a bomb-able wall.

Great fairy of wisdom:
This Great fairy doubles Link's magic meter. She is located inside the Death Mountain crater. Face the entrance to Goron City (inside the crater). A bridge will be to the right. Use the Megaton Hammer (obtained after passing the Fire Temple) to destroy the rocks blocking the entrance. Bombs will have no effect.

Great fairy of courage:
This Great fairy doubles adult Link's defensive powers. She is located near Ganon's castle. Obtain the Golden Gauntlets inside Ganon's castle. Use them to lift the column that is blocking the entrance, which is to the right, when facing Ganon's tower.

Great fairy of magic:
This Great fairy is located at the same spot as the Great fairy of courage when Link is a child. Use a bomb to open the entrance. She will give Link a new spell, "Din's Fire".

Great fairy of magic:
She is located behind Zora's fountain, when Link is a kid. Move all the way behind the fountain to find a piece of land. Then, destroy the wall behind it. She will give Link a new spell, "Ferore's Wind".

Great fairy of magic:
This great fairy is located between the two palm trees at the desert colossus. Use a bomb at the crack on the wall. She will give Link the "Nayru's Love" spell.

Free fairies:
Stand in front of a Gossip Stone and play Zelda's Lullaby and two or three fairies will come out of it. Gossip Stones can be found right in front or beside a temple or dungeon. Note: This may only be done once per Gossip Stone.

Big Poe locations:
Big Poe locations are signified by a little Poe appearing when you are not on a horse. Their locations are as follows:
Sign in front of Hyrule Castle.
Overhang near Kakariko entrence.
Bush near northwest of field.
Tree in front of Lon Lon ranch.
Tree in southeast of field.
Choppable bushes near southeast of field.
Big gray rock.
Y-shaped intersection near where field turns into Gerudo terrain.
V-shaped wall near Lon Lon ranch.
Tree near Gerudo.
